A comprehensive textbook covering numerical methods and their application to data analysis. It presents algorithms and techniques for solving linear equations, interpolation, differentiation and integration, differential and integral equations, least squares, Fourier analysis, probability, and statistical inference — designed to help scientists and engineers understand and correctly apply numerical computation rather than treating computation as a “black box.”
